DUPRI NAMED PRESIDENT OF ISLAND URBAN MUSIC
After leaving his previous gig at Virgin Records last year in the wake of girlfriend Janet Jackson's disappointing album sales, Jermaine Dupri has bounced back and into the plush executive chair at Island Def Jam Records.
Jermaine Dupri has been appointed president of Island Records Urban Music, a new division of the IDJ Music Group. Under the new deal, Dupri will oversee Island's entire urban music operation, as well as produce artists on the rosters of both IDJ and the entire Universal Music Group family of labels. Dupri will report directly to Chairman L.A. Reid and Island President, Steve Bartels on operational matters.
